The Stealth Cam DNVB digital night vision binoculars deliver solid low-light performance for hunting and wildlife observation. 4 aperture and 850nm IR LEDs provide clear views up to 440 feet in darkness, and the 9x digital zoom lets you get closer to distant subjects. The rubberized housing feels tough and provides a secure grip, even in wet conditions. 3MP and 640x480) and reliance on 6 AA batteries for power. Battery life is decent at 9 hours day and 5 hours night, but you'll want rechargeables to keep costs down.
